Embodiment Construction

[0053] First, refer to Figure 1 and figure 2 , Curtains 10 and 12 are mounted on a curtain rod 14 in a conventional manner. A valance cord 16 is placed over the curtain rod 14 and engages the curtains 10 and 12 mounted on the curtain rod 14 proximate to a supporting surface (eg, ceiling or wall 17). At each end of the curtain rod 14 a stopper 18 is provided.

[0054] In Figure 1 and figure 2 In this case, a valance driver according to the present invention is indicated by reference numeral 20 . The valance driver 20 is secured to the wall 17 adjacent to the curtain 12 and engages the valance cord 16 . The location of the valance actuator 20 is not particularly limited and may vary according to the wall space allocated to each side of the curtains 10 and 12 .

Abstract

A drapery actuator to open and close draperies, comprising a housing and a drive pulley supported by the housing to engage a drapery cord coupled to a drape. A motor, typically a D.C. motor, is supported by the housing for providing torque to reversibly rotate the drive pulley to move the drapery cord between a first extreme (typically closed) position and a second extreme (typically open) position. A first electrical switch operatively connected to the motor functions as a cut-out switch and reversing switch to stop the motor from continued turning in a given direction and thereafter switching polarity, to allow the motor to turn in an opposite direction when the switch is re-activated. A torque-activated mechanism is provided, adapted to actuate the first electrical switch when the drive pulley moves the drapery cord to the first position, and is further adapted to actuate the first electrical switch when the drive pulley is reversibly rotated by the motor to move the drapery cord to the second position.

Description

technical field [0001] This invention relates to a valance drive and, more particularly, to an electric drive for opening and closing a valance or the like. Background technique [0002] This application is a continuation-in-part of US Patent Application S / N 08 / 703,760, filed August 27,1996. [0003] Originally, to open the valance, the valance was manually moved along a valance cord between an open position and a closed position. This of course effectively regulates the amount of light entering the room. [0004] It is always desirable to have various electric valance actuators to open and close valances. The valance drive has a drive pulley that engages a valance cord that engages the valance or the like. The action of the drive pulley opens and closes the valance. In order for the drive pulley to effectively move the valance cord, the valance cord must have the proper tension.
